Wedding gala shopping list

A wedding gala needs more than dinner plates and champagne glasses. Plan each place setting, drink service and buffet station before you shop, then add a small reserve for breakage and late changes. This list covers the practical supplies behind a formal meal: linens, tableware, serving equipment, coffee service and cloakroom items. Confirm dietary requirements and the final guest count before buying anything perishable or ordering rental quantities.

Tips

  • Count tableware by course and guest: allow one dinner plate, dessert plate, soup bowl, fork, knife and dessert spoon per person, then add 5–10% extra for replacements and second servings.
  • Plan glassware separately from place settings. For a seated gala, provide at least one water glass and one wine glass per guest; add champagne glasses for the toast and keep 10% extra if washing glasses during the event is not possible.
  • Give each buffet station its own serving equipment. A station serving two hot dishes needs at least two serving platters or covered serving dishes, matching serving utensils and a buffet warmer for each dish that must stay hot.
  • Do not leave coffee service until the last minute. Allow one coffee cup and spoon per guest, enough thermos flasks or coffee machines for the expected service period, and confirm access to power and water before delivery day.
  • Check the cloakroom before guests arrive: provide one coat hanger per expected coat, plus a few spare hangers, and place garment racks where they do not block the entrance or dining area.

Frequently asked questions

How many plates and glasses do I need for a wedding gala?
Start with one item per planned course and guest: dinner plates, dessert plates and any soup bowls, plus one water glass and one wine glass each. Add 5–10% extra, and count champagne glasses separately if there is a toast.
How much table linen do I need for a wedding gala?
Prepare one tablecloth or linen set for every dining table, plus at least one spare for spills. Measure the round tables and buffet tables first; linen sizes that are too small are difficult to fix on the day.
How many buffet warmers are needed for a wedding gala?
Use one buffet warmer for each hot dish or serving container that must remain warm. Add one spare only if the meal runs for several hours or replacement equipment will be difficult to obtain during service.
When should I buy supplies for a wedding gala?
Confirm the final guest count and dietary requirements 2–3 weeks before the gala, then order rental items and non-perishables. Buy fresh produce and chill drinks close to the event, usually 1–2 days beforehand.
